Transaction 74e27f92e301c189bf67a20bd6acb281b73f78b8de70c39540885da1cb70899f
1 Input
2 Outputs
- 74e27f92e301c189bf67a20bd6acb281b73f78b8de70c39540885da1cb70899f:0
- 74e27f92e301c189bf67a20bd6acb281b73f78b8de70c39540885da1cb70899f:1
value 20000000
address 1J5bFSxNxJrcpMwPzsinJYwc9FtqVp5ygp
value 20227988
address 126sFiaRjBaj7DDm281y39NuNY3oeCjdcQ